Measuring for Fit
Getting the right fit is the first step. If you have thinning, you need to measure the area you want to cover. Here’s how you can do it:
Use a soft measuring tape to measure across the crown, from one side of thinning to the other.
Measure from your natural hairline back to the end of the thinning area.
Make sure you include all the thinning spots, not just the most obvious ones.
Check that you have enough healthy hair around the thinning area for the clips to attach securely.
Avoid common mistakes like skipping the back of the crown or underestimating the size of your thinning.

Color Matching Tips
Blending your topper with your natural hair is key for a seamless look. If you want your thinning to stay your secret, follow these tips:
Ask a professional stylist to help match your color, especially if you have highlights or multiple tones.
Order a color ring and compare swatches to the hair framing your face.
Always check your hair color in natural light for the best match.
Take photos of your hair outside to use as a reference.

Maintenance and Care
Taking care of your topper keeps it looking fresh and extends its life. If you have thinning, gentle care is even more important.
Detangle your topper with a wide-tooth comb before washing.
Wash once a week with sulfate-free shampoo and conditioner.
Soak the topper in lukewarm water—don’t scrub.
Apply conditioner to the hair, not the base.
Air dry your topper on a wig stand or mannequin head.
Store your topper in a cool, dry place, away from sunlight.
Switch up the placement to avoid tension on thinning spots.
Avoid sleeping on your topper and let it rest when not in use.

FAQ
Can I style my hair topper with heat tools?
Yes, you can style most human hair toppers with curling irons or straighteners. Always check the care instructions. If you use heat, keep the temperature low to protect the hair.
How do I secure my topper for all-day wear?
You attach your topper using built-in clips. Make sure you place the clips on healthy hair. Press each clip firmly. If you need extra security, try a few bobby pins.
Will my topper match my hair color?
You can choose from many shades. Alpha offers custom color options. If you want a perfect match, ask your stylist for help or use a color ring.
How often should I wash my hair topper?
Wash your topper every one to two weeks. Use sulfate-free shampoo and conditioner. Let it air dry. Too much washing can shorten the lifespan.
Can I sleep in my hair topper?
You should remove your topper before sleeping. This keeps the clips and hair in good shape. Store your topper on a wig stand or in a box.
